N-[2-nitro-4-(trifluoromethyl)phenyl]piperazine is a biologically active compound belonging to the piperazine group. It is an important synthetic intermediate used in the preparation of a wide range of drugs, agrochemicals and other chemicals. It is considered an inhibitor of certain enzymes involved in drug metabolism, such as cytochrome P450 enzymes, and has also been shown to have anti-inflammatory and antitumor effects.

| Molecular Weight | 275.23 |
| Formula | C11H12F3N3O2 |
| Cas No. | 58315-38-1 |
| Smiles | [O-][N+](=O)C1=C(C=CC(=C1)C(F)(F)F)N1CCNCC1 |
| Storage | Powder: -20°C for 3 years | In solvent: -80°C for 1 year | Shipping with blue ice/Shipping at ambient temperature. | |||||||||||||||||||||||||||||||||||
| Solubility Information | DMSO: 60 mg/mL (218 mM), Sonication is recommended. | |||||||||||||||||||||||||||||||||||
